Most decentralized platforms are still in early iteration mode. Content feeds getting flooded with repetitive topics based on recent user activity? Common growing pain. These friction points will likely iron themselves out as the systems mature.
But here's what matters: the underlying philosophy is solid. The real win comes when platforms can separate genuine signal from noise—filtering meaningful engagement over algorithmic spam. That's the north star worth chasing. Signal quality beats raw information volume every time in Web3 ecosystems.
